The cheapest way to get from Putney Bridge Station to Chancery Lane is to drive which costs £1 - £2 and takes 19 min.
The fastest way to get from Putney Bridge Station to Chancery Lane is to taxi which takes 19 min and costs £45 - £55.
No, there is no direct bus from Putney Bridge Station station to Chancery Lane. However, there are services departing from Putney Bridge Station / Gonville Street and arriving at Fetter Lane via Haymarket / Jermyn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 17m.
Yes, there is a direct ferry departing from Putney Pier and arriving at Blackfriars Pier. Services depart hourly, and operate Monday to Friday. The journey takes approximately 53 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Putney Bridge station station and arriving at Temple station station.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 24 min.
The distance between Putney Bridge Station and Chancery Lane is 7 miles. The road distance is 5.8 miles.
The best way to get from Putney Bridge Station to Chancery Lane without a car is to subway which takes 31 min and costs £5 - £20.
The subway from Putney Bridge station to Temple station takes 24 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
